Such errors are likely to be larger than calibration errors. SeaCat salinity errors are expected to be as high as 0.05 units in areas of high gradients. For these data the descent rate was quite steady and temperature and salinity gradients were not extreme, so the error is likely much smaller than that. No calibration sampling was available for this cruise or any other cruise since the last factory calibration.
